You will need to reconfigure your mlint programs:

M-x customize-variable RET mlint-programs RET

And specify the location of your MATLAB install where the mlint command-line 
program is, not the mlint.el Emacs program.

This particular part of mlint hasn't changed much over the past few years.

Hi all,

I have recently downloaded matlab-emacs from both the sourceforge page (at work 
where we use matlab 7.10 and emacs 23) and with the built in package manager 
for emacs 24 (I think that version of matlab is slightly younger). I cannot get 
mlint to do anything with either setup. When I have a .m file open and 
matlab-mode on syntax is highlighted, but mlint doesn't seem to do anything at 
all - it doesn't highlight erroneous syntax like I would like it to. The first 
time I tried using mlint, it asked me to configure it which I did by setting 
the directory to the directory where mlint.el is (and when I try to scan a 
document the minibuffer pops up with "Searching for program:  Success 
[malab-emacs directory]", so I think that matlab-mode knows where mlint.el is.

Does it work? Am I missing something obvious? Can anyone help me out? I realize 
that this package is getting a bit long in the tooth and that they keep 
changing matlab, but I was *really* hoping this would work out.
